Truisms are the opposite of falsisms or statements that are clearly wrong. Often, aphorisms are examples of truisms when they present a universally accepted truth or opinion. Clichés and platitudes are even more common examples. Truisms are often subjective. This means that they might, for some, be hard to detect.

They become great … WebThe majority of truisms don’t fit into any type or category. They’re just bland statements. However, there are more specific terms for a couple types of truisms: A platitude is a truism on a moral topic. We’ll see an example of this later on. A bromide is a comforting truism, e.g. “things always work out in the end.” III. Examples of ...
